Output c60bb6d611faf50060befaabe40e7fc366001232137587601c7eeb030cbfdc8b:0

value
102223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d844d0a1bcb73b281a4433127e667d09df65c1ea OP_EQUAL
address
3MQYKKv1EGhTuUH2gdMepvpzmu3rZ4VJj6
transaction
c60bb6d611faf50060befaabe40e7fc366001232137587601c7eeb030cbfdc8b
confirmations
163919
spent
true